Until the first stump? Named the biggest “jamb” of the new LADA 4×4, and how to deal with it

It seems that the “Niva” has not changed, except for the interior, the statement is incorrect. AvtoVAZ engineers from LADA 4×4 made a city crossover, making a controversial change in design.

LADA 4×4, it seems, from the once “all-inclusive” “Niva” is gradually turning into a “SUV”, becoming more and more “tender”. Contrary to the opinion that the car did not undergo any global changes, except for having acquired a new modernized interior, AvtoVAZ engineers nevertheless made changes to the design.

An unpleasant “discovery” was shared by a blogger and owner of the updated LADA 4×4 on his YouTube channel “Arseny Engineer”. It turns out that the designers controversially “modified” the restyled “Niva”: they “untied” the front gearbox and simply “laid” it on the transverse stabilizer without thinking of any protection.

On the one hand, it speeds up and reduces the cost of production. On the other hand, it does not at all give the car reliability, drastically reducing the patency. After all, an important node in a fragile silumin case now “hangs” above the ground and when meeting with the first “stump” threatens to “scatter.”

Owners of the new LADA 4×4 can prevent troubles on their own by installing a protection kit. But the blogger warns that the installation of protection will “take away” about 5 cm from the ground clearance. Otherwise, leaving the city and “moving out” of asphalt in the “mud” and “gully”, you may find that the “Niva” is no longer an SUV and the “gentle” little “SUV”, only disguised as the good old “Niva” – a favorite of offroad fans.
